
Raiders Pro Bowl running back Josh Jacobs was arrested on suspicion of driving under the influence after he was injured in a single car crash in Las Vegas early Monday morning, according to police. Jacobs, who had scored a crucial touchdown in the final seconds of the Raiders’ season-ending 32-31 win over the Broncos, was taken to a hospital for minor injuries at around 4:40 a.m. Las Vegas police said Jacobs was involved in an accident near the McCarran Airport Connector and East Sunset Road in Las Vegas.
